- Troubleshoots automated equipment failures to determine necessary upgrades and/or repairs
- Read and understand equipment manuals and electrical schematics
- Documentation of the activities carried out and the results of work
- Work with Controls/Manufacturing Engineers to develop equipment and controls for new products as well as improving existing equipment (cycle time, scrap reduction, improved quality, etc)
- Perform preventive maintenance as assigned which includes but is not limited to repair, diagnose, clean, lubricate, upgrade manufacturing equipment, glue dispensing equipment, plasma treat equipment, slide actuators, hoist, conveyors, etc.
- Provide support to troubleshoot and recover any problem with robots on the production line
- Follow all safety procedures and protocols while servicing or maintaining equipment
- Performs other related duties as assigned
- Successfully completed vocational training in electrical engineering/mechatronics or comparable training preferred
- At least three years of related experience preferred
- Professional experience in maintenance and with automated systems, focusing on assembly technology
- Working knowledge of tools, and devices such as torque guns, volts meters etc.
- Experience with basic electrical systems (e.g., PLC, sensors, fuses, contacts, relays) and with the ability to read and use mechanical and electrical schematics for repairs and troubleshooting
- Ability to troubleshoot and repair industrial electronic, pneumatic, and hydraulic system components, such as pumps, valves, cylinders, motors, and solenoids.
- Experience with basic handling of robots from pendant (KUKA preferably)
- Experience troubleshooting controls circuitry (AC/DC power supplies, relays, motors / servos) is required
- PLC experience is a plus
- Willing to work non-traditional hours including nights, weekends, and holidays with on-call availability
- Ability to use hand and power tool
- Ability to work under pressure and multi-task
- High level of commitment as well as a responsible, independent, and team-oriented way of working
- Familiar with Lock Out Tag Out
- Excellent organizational and time management skills

Description
An Automation Technician is responsible for providing technical support and resources to manufacturing and engineering processes and equipment. The Technician must ensure that the equipment and processes are maintained at the highest level of safety, quality, efficiency, productivity. Additionally, the Automation Technician is responsible for installing and repairing systems, apparatus, electrical and electronic components of industrial machinery and equipment.About us
